1969 Volvo 142 Bulb Size Chart
| Position | Bulb Size | Shop |
|---|---|---|
| Turn Signal Front | 1156 | Buy 1156 → |
| Low Beam | H6024 | Buy H6024 → |
| Turn Signal Rear | 1156 | Buy 1156 → |
| Brake Light | 1157 | Buy 1157 → |
| Parking Light | 1157 | Buy 1157 → |
| Tail Light | 1157 | Buy 1157 → |
| Dome Light | DE3423 | Buy DE3423 → |
